Page of Cups
YouTarot Version

Upright Meaning
The Page of Cups symbolizes creativity, intuition, and new emotional experiences. This card represents a youthful spirit, open to imagination and feelings, often leading to new ideas and inspirations. The image captures the essence of emotional exploration and the beauty of dreams in a beautifully simple setting.

Reversed
Reversed, the Page of Cups can indicate emotional immaturity or insecurity. Creativity may be blocked or delayed, and there could be misunderstandings or emotional disappointments. It encourages reflection and caution with new emotional ventures.

Traditional Rider-Waite

Upright Meaning
In the Rider-Waite tradition, the Page of Cups is a messenger of emotional beginnings and creative opportunities. It signifies curiosity, a sensitive and gentle nature, and an openness to new feelings and experiences. Often associated with young people or youthful energy, this card encourages exploration and the embrace of new possibilities in relationships and creativity.

Reversed
When reversed, the Page of Cups in the Rider-Waite deck suggests emotional insecurity, creative blocks, or immaturity. It can warn of unrealistic expectations or emotional confusion that might lead to disappointment.
